Psalm 53

Psalm 53

A Portrait of Sinners

For the choir director: on Mahalath.(A) A Maskil of David.

The fool says in his heart, “There’s no God.”
They are corrupt, and they do vile deeds.
There is no one who does good.(B)
God looks down from heaven on the human race[a]
to see if there is one who is wise,
one who seeks God.(C)
All have turned away;
all alike have become corrupt.
There is no one who does good,
not even one.(D)

Will evildoers never understand?
They consume my people as they consume bread;(E)
they do not call on God.(F)
Then they will be filled with dread—
dread like no other(G)
because God will scatter
the bones of those who besiege you.(H)
You will put them to shame,
for God has rejected them.(I)

Oh, that Israel’s deliverance would come from Zion!
When God restores the fortunes of his people,[b]
let Jacob rejoice, let Israel be glad.(J)

1 Samuel 15:24-31

24 Saul answered Samuel, “I have sinned.(A) I have transgressed the Lord’s command(B) and your words. Because I was afraid of the people, I obeyed them. 25 Now therefore, please forgive my sin(C) and return with me so I can worship the Lord.”

26 Samuel replied to Saul, “I will not return with you. Because you rejected the word of the Lord,(D) the Lord has rejected you from being king over Israel.” 27 When Samuel turned to go, Saul grabbed the corner of his robe, and it tore. 28 Samuel said to him, “The Lord has torn the kingship of Israel away from you today(E) and has given it to your neighbor who is better than you.(F) 29 Furthermore, the Eternal One of Israel(G) does not lie or change his mind, for he is not man who changes his mind.”(H)

30 Saul said, “I have sinned. Please honor me(I) now before the elders of my people and before Israel. Come back with me so I can bow in worship to the Lord your God.”(J) 31 Then Samuel went back, following Saul, and Saul bowed down to the Lord.

Luke 6:43-45

A Tree and Its Fruit

43 “A good tree doesn’t produce bad fruit; on the other hand, a bad tree doesn’t produce good fruit.[a](A) 44 For each tree is known by its own fruit. Figs aren’t gathered from thornbushes, or grapes picked from a bramble bush. 45 A good person produces good out of the good stored up in his heart. An evil person produces evil out of the evil stored up in his heart, for his mouth speaks from the overflow of the heart.
